Database Examples to Enhance Your Project: Get Inspired

There are 25 database project ideas, with 9 being real-world projects. This shows how important database examples are for projects. As businesses use data more, they need more database experts. Doing a database project helps you learn about database management and SQL.

It gives you hands-on experience with databases and writing SQL queries. Database examples are key for inspiration. They help beginners start their projects. In this article, we’ll look at different database examples. We’ll cover common, real-world, and creative designs, all important for database projects.

Finding the right idea for your database project can be tough. Database examples help you solve problems, like organizing data and making queries faster. A good database project can make your portfolio stand out. It shows you’re proactive and skilled in database design and SQL.

There are public datasets for exploring real-world data. You can use them in your projects. This makes database examples very valuable for project development.

Table of Contents

Key Takeaways

  • 25 database project ideas are available for implementation, with 9 being real-world projects.
  • Database examples for project development are essential for sparking inspiration and providing hands-on experience with managing databases and writing SQL queries.
  • Sample database projects can help beginners get started with project database design.
  • Database examples can help develop problem-solving skills, such as organizing data, ensuring accuracy, and improving query speed.
  • A well-designed database project can significantly enhance a portfolio, showing initiative and technical skills in database design and SQL.
  • Public datasets are available for exploring real-world data in areas such as weather, finance, and demographics, which can be utilized in database projects.
  • Database examples for project development are essential for creating a complete and effective database management system.

Understanding the Fundamentals of Database Projects

When diving into database projects, knowing the basics is key. You need to grasp the different types of databases, like relational, NoSQL, and NewSQL. Planning is vital, focusing on tables, indexes, and views. Using templates can make the process smoother and build a strong base for your project.

A good database is vital for managing and getting data quickly. Relational databases use SQL for complex queries. NoSQL databases, by contrast, grow easily and offer various models.

database project templates

Tables, rows, and columns are key for organizing data well. Important design rules, like data normalization, should guide your project. With the right templates, you can build a database that’s both strong and flexible.

When starting a database project, consider a few things:

  • Choosing the right database management system
  • Designing a robust and scalable database architecture
  • Implementing effective data security and backup measures

Why Database Examples Matter for Project Success

Database examples are key to a project’s success. They give developers a starting point for their own projects. By looking at database examples for project development, developers can learn from others. They can avoid mistakes and create better databases.

A well-designed database is vital for a project’s performance and growth. This is why project database design is so important.

Using sample database projects can spark new ideas. Developers can see what works and what doesn’t. This helps them make better design choices, which is critical for complex projects.

When looking at database examples for project development, consider a few things:

  • Scalability: How will the database handle growth?
  • Performance: How fast can it handle data?
  • Security: How safe is it from threats?

By evaluating these and using sample database projects as guides, developers can make databases that meet their project’s needs. These databases will help the project succeed.

database examples for project

Common Database Examples for Project Implementation

Choosing the right database project idea is key. It depends on the project type and your goals. Database projects can be complex, but the right templates make it easier. We’ll look at common examples like CRM databases, inventory systems, HR databases, and educational databases.

These examples are great for starting your database project. They offer a solid base for your work. Using templates saves time and ensures your database is organized and effective.

database project implementation

  • Customer Relationship Management (CRM) databases, which help businesses manage customer interactions and data
  • Inventory Management Systems, which enable companies to track and manage their inventory levels and supply chain
  • Human Resources databases, which store employee data and help with payroll and benefits management
  • Educational Institution databases, which manage student data, grades, and attendance

By looking at these examples and using templates, you can build a strong database. It will meet your project needs and help you reach your goals.

Selecting the Right Database Model for Your Project

Choosing the right database model is key for database project implementation. You need to think about data structure, scalability, and performance. The best model depends on your project’s specific needs.

There are many database models to pick from, like relational, NoSQL, and NewSQL. Relational databases work well for projects needing strong data consistency and complex transactions. NoSQL databases are great for projects needing high scalability and fast data access. Database project templates can help you start designing and implementing a database.

Popular choices include PostgreSQL, MySQL, and Microsoft SQL Server for relational databases. For NoSQL databases, MongoDB, Cassandra, and Redis are good options. When picking a database, think about performance, scalability, and security. The right model can greatly impact your project’s success, so database project implementation should be well-planned.

database project ideas

By picking the right database model, developers can ensure a successful database project implementation. You need to evaluate data structure, scalability, and performance. Choose a database that fits these needs. With the right model, developers can build a strong and efficient database that supports the project’s goals.

Database Type Description
Relational Well-suited for projects that require strong data consistency and complex transactions
NoSQL Ideal for projects that require high scalability and fast read/write operations
NewSQL Combines the advantages of relational and NoSQL databases while preserving ACID properties

Real-World Database Examples for Project Inspiration

Looking at real-world database examples can inspire your project. These examples show how to organize data effectively. For example, Amazon uses databases for product info, orders, and payments. This shows how a database can be designed for a specific project.

In healthcare, databases store patient data and treatment plans. These databases need to be secure and private. By studying these examples, developers can learn to design better databases for their projects.

database examples for project

  • Social media platforms, which use databases to store user data, posts, and interactions
  • Online banking systems, which use databases to store customer account information and transaction history
  • Hotel booking systems, which use databases to manage reservations and guest data

By looking at these examples, developers can understand how to create effective databases. They can make sample database projects that fit their needs.

Database Project Templates to Jump-Start Development

Having the right tools is key for database projects. Templates can give you a head start by providing a ready-made structure. They help you start your project, whether it’s simple or complex, and can be tailored to fit your needs.

Templates can save you a lot of time and effort. For instance, Directus templates can set up a database project in minutes. ClickUp also has free templates for tasks like inventory management and contact lists.

Visual Studio offers 15 project templates to get you started. These templates are great for web apps or mobile apps. database project templates

Choosing the right template is important. Look for ones that are easy to customize and grow with your project. The right template can help you create a database that meets your goals. Using templates can make your project smoother and more effective.

Essential Tools for Database Project Creation

Choosing the right tools is key for database project implementation. There are many options, from database management software to design tools. It’s important to pick tools that match the project’s needs and the team’s skills.

Database project templates should work well with different tools and software. This makes database project implementation smoother and speeds up development. For example, SQL Server database projects fit well into CI/CD workflows, following development best practices.

database project tools

  • MySQL Workbench for data modeling and SQL development
  • Microsoft SQL Server Management Studio for advanced analytics
  • PostgreSQL with pgAdmin for reliability and support for advanced data types

These tools are essential for turning database project ideas into reality. They help ensure the database project implementation is successful.

Best Practices for Database Project Implementation

When starting a database project, it’s important to remember a few key things. You should think about security considerations, how to make it run fast, and how it will grow. These steps help make sure your database project works well and meets your goals.

Choosing the right database is a big part of this. You need to think about the CAP theorem, data models, and what databases are popular. Picking the best database helps your project run smoothly. Also, remember to think about what your users and stakeholders need.

database project implementation

Other important steps include:
* Testing the database to make sure it works as expected
* Using version control to keep track of changes
* Deploying the database in a safe and efficient way
* Keeping an eye on and improving the database’s performance
By doing these things, you can make sure your database project is a success. It will be strong and efficient, meeting all your needs.

Creative Approaches to Database Design

Creating a well-designed database is key for managing data efficiently. A good project database design should focus on data normalization, denormalization, and scalability. Developers can make a strong, adaptable database by using various design patterns and principles.

Using both relational and NoSQL databases is a smart move. This mix leverages the best of both worlds, making the database more efficient and scalable. For instance, relational databases are great for structured data, while NoSQL databases handle unstructured or semi-structured data well.

Starting with a sample database project can be helpful. It gives developers a solid base for their database design. By tweaking and expanding the sample project, they can tailor their database to their app’s needs.

database design

Popular design patterns like the star and snowflake schema are useful. They help organize data into facts and dimensions, making it easier to analyze and access. These patterns help developers build a more efficient and scalable database system.

In summary, creative database design is vital for building efficient systems. By exploring different patterns and principles, developers can craft a robust, adaptable database. Whether using a hybrid approach, a sample project, or a specific pattern, the goal is a well-designed database that supports the app and allows for growth.

Database Project Management Strategies

Managing a database project well is key to its success. It involves planning, doing the work, and checking on progress. This ensures the project is done on time, within budget, and meets quality standards. Using database project templates helps organize the project’s structure and flow.

A good plan for a database project can save money, make things more efficient, and improve quality. It’s important to pick the right template based on the project’s size, complexity, and needs. For instance, a small project might need a simple template, while a big project might require a more detailed one.

Some important strategies for managing a database project include:

  • Timeline planning: creating a detailed project schedule and timeline
  • Resource allocation: assigning tasks and resources to team members
  • Quality assurance: monitoring and controlling the project’s quality

By using these strategies and choosing the right template, organizations can make sure their database projects succeed. With good planning and management, database project ideas can become a reality.

database project management

Common Challenges and Solutions in Database Projects

When working on database projects, it’s key to think about the challenges you might face. Poor design and planning can cause delays and higher costs. To avoid this, spend time on a detailed database project template.

Another issue is not normalizing data correctly. This can cause data problems and make upkeep hard. Using templates helps ensure data is organized properly from the start.

Common mistakes include not using SQL to keep data safe and not naming things well. These errors can confuse people and make upkeep hard. By using templates and following best practices, you can avoid these mistakes and have a successful project.

database project ideas

  • Invest time in creating a well-structured database project template
  • Implement normalization from the start
  • Use SQL facilities to protect data integrity
  • Follow proper naming standards

By sticking to these practices and using templates, you can tackle common problems. This approach helps avoid delays and high costs. It leads to a well-organized and easy-to-maintain database.

Advanced Database Features for Enhanced Functionality

When you’re making a project database, think about adding advanced features. These can make your database work better and faster. Features like triggers, stored procedures, views, and indexing can help a lot.

A good project database design should match your project’s needs. For big datasets, indexing can speed up queries. For complex tasks, triggers and stored procedures are great.

Views and materialized views are also useful. They simplify complex data, making it easier to work with. Using these features can make your database more powerful and efficient.

Database Integration with Modern Technologies

When it comes to database project ideas, using modern tech is key. This means working with cloud computing, big data, and AI. It helps keep all business data in one place, making it easier to manage worldwide.

Using database project templates makes things easier. It lets companies focus on big plans, not just getting data ready. With the right tools, they can handle lots of data and see their business clearly.

Database integration brings many benefits. It makes operations better, improves how users interact, and speeds up projects. It also makes keeping data safe and following rules easier.

Cloud and big data tools offer great advantages. They provide cost-effective solutions, grow with your business, and offer insights in real-time. With the right approach and tools, companies can make the most of their data and succeed.

Performance Monitoring and Optimization Tips

Monitoring and optimizing database performance is key for a great user experience. A well-optimized database means faster responses and happier users. To get there, track important performance metrics, fix problems, and keep up with maintenance.

Watch for response time, throughput, and how resources are used. These metrics help spot issues early. Using database project templates can make monitoring and optimization easier.

Regular maintenance, like optimizing indexes and updating stats, keeps performance high. Caching and database partitioning also boost query speed and cut down on delays. By following these tips, your database project will run smoothly, giving users a better experience and improving your database’s performance.

Future-Proofing Your Database Project

Future-proofing your database project is key for lasting success. It means making smart design choices that make future updates easier. This way, you spend less time and fewer resources on changes. By looking at database examples for project and project database design, you lay a strong base for your project.

A good database project can grow with your needs. It should handle big changes, like thousands or millions of users at once. Sample database projects show how to do this. Also, breaking your project into smaller parts makes it easier to handle as it gets bigger.

To make your database project future-ready, keep these tips in mind:

  • Plan for scalability and flexibility
  • Use modularization to isolate changes
  • Consider abstraction to increase flexibility

By following these tips and looking at database examples for project and project database design, you’ll build a project that can grow and change easily. This ensures your project’s success for years to come.

Conclusion: Taking Your Database Project from Concept to Reality

Bringing your database project ideas to life starts with a solid plan. You need to pick the right database model and use effective templates. This makes your database work well, keeping data accurate and easy to use.

A good database design cuts down on unnecessary data. This saves space and lowers errors. For example, using AutoNumber for primary keys makes sure each record is unique. This helps keep data consistent across different tables.

Following best practices and using the right tools is key. Whether it’s for e-commerce, healthcare, or social media, a well-designed database is vital. With the right approach, your project can grow and improve, helping your business succeed.

FAQ

What are the benefits of using database examples for project implementation?

Database examples give developers a starting point for their projects. They inspire new ideas and help avoid common mistakes. This leads to more efficient and effective databases.

What are the different types of database management systems?

There are several types of database management systems. These include relational, NoSQL, and NewSQL databases. Each has its own strengths and weaknesses, fitting different projects and applications.

What are the core components of a database?

The core of a database includes tables, indexes, and views. These are key to designing an efficient database. They ensure data is consistent and reliable.

What are some common database examples for project implementation?

Common examples include CRM databases, inventory systems, and human resources databases. These can serve as a starting point for various projects.

How do I select the right database model for my project?

To choose the right model, consider data structure, scalability, and performance. Pick a model that fits your project’s needs, like relational, NoSQL, or NewSQL databases.

What are some real-world database examples for project inspiration?

Real-world examples include e-commerce databases, healthcare systems, and social media structures. They offer inspiration and guidance for projects.

What are database project templates and how can they be used?

Database project templates offer a pre-designed structure and schema. They help jump-start development, saving time and ensuring accuracy. They’re available for various databases, including relational, NoSQL, and NewSQL.

What are some essential tools for database project creation?

Essential tools include popular database management software and design tools. Examples are MySQL, Oracle, and Microsoft SQL Server. They offer features for design, development, and management.

What are some best practices for database project implementation?

Best practices include security, performance optimization, and scalability planning. These are vital for a successful database project. Techniques like data encryption and indexing help achieve this.

What are some creative approaches to database design?

Creative approaches include data normalization and denormalization. These optimize database structure for better performance and data integrity. Techniques like data modeling help achieve this.

What are some common challenges and solutions in database projects?

Common challenges include data modeling and query development. Solutions include data normalization and indexing. Using the right tools and technologies helps overcome these challenges.

What are some advanced database features for enhanced functionality?

Advanced features include triggers and stored procedures. Views and indexing strategies also enhance functionality. They improve performance and support complex applications.

How can I integrate my database project with modern technologies?

Integrate your project with cloud computing, big data, and AI. Techniques like data migration and API integration offer new opportunities for data analysis and visualization.

What are some performance monitoring and optimization tips for database projects?

Performance tips include key performance indicators and troubleshooting. Maintenance schedules also help identify and resolve issues. These ensure optimal system performance.

How can I future-proof my database project?

To future-proof, consider scalability, flexibility, and adaptability. Plan for changes and upgrades. This ensures the project’s long-term success and relevance.

Leave a Comment